1393 Riverside Rd, Bluff City, Tn 37618 is where Thomas resides. The current age of Thomas is 44. Thomas's possible relatives are Sandra Marie Pepper, Mary Elizabeth Olcott, Jackie Jean Pepper and 3 other people. Thomas owns the phone number (314) 200-9136. Thomas was born in 1981. Cities Thomas has lived in before are Pevely, Imperial, Saint Louis and 6 other cities.